Matchwinner Lauren Hemp described City’s 2-1 triumph over Everton as a 'massive win', after her second half strike fired Gareth Taylor’s side to the top of the Barclays WSL table.

On our return to club action after the February international break, Hemp’s brilliant second half strike added to Bunny Shaw’s first half opener to put City in control at the Joie Stadium.

Though Everton narrowed the deficit with a fine Hannah Bennison effort, City deservedly held on to secure what was a 12th successive win across all competitions and one which Hemp believed was priceless.

“That was a massive win. We needed that today coming off the international break,” the England international reflected.

“We wanted to hit the ground running like we did before the break and that was the most important thing.

“Obviously it’s also nice to contribute with a goal.

“I could have added a couple more to be honest, but we got the job done which was the most important thing.”
